Job Description

We are designing the grid of the future!

The Senior Distribution Design Manager will provide strategic leadership and oversight for EPE’s Distribution Design & Engineering business in the Southeastern U.S, leading a team of designers and engineers supporting multiple utility clients. This role is responsible for managing distribution design and engineering projects, cultivating client relationships, overseeing project portfolios, driving staff development, and supporting business growth. The ideal candidate combines strong technical expertise in utility distribution systems with proven leadership, project management, and client management skills, while remaining actively engaged in project execution and the delivery of high-quality client solutions. This candidate will also be located in Southeastern U.S..

Qualifications

Bring your passion, here what’s needed:

  • 7 to 10+ years experience working in Distribution Design with an emphasis on complex overhead and underground designs
  • Bachelor of Science or higher in Electrical Engineering, Mechanical Engineer or Civil Engineering
  • Professional Engineer (PE) license required.
  • Prior hands on experience performing distribution designs
  • Understanding of NESC, GO95 and NEC standards
  • Proficiency in CAD software and other design tools.
  • Experience leveraging AI and automation tools responsibly to improve quality, productivity and innovation
  • Prior leadership experience whether it be formal or informal management/leadership
  • Ability to communicate effectively with clients and external vendors
  • Experience leveraging AI and automation tools responsibly to improve quality, productivity and innovation under experience
  • Understanding of regulatory requirements and industry standards related to utility distribution systems

About Electric Power Engineers

Electric Power Engineers (EPE) is a global advisory and engineering firm advancing grid reliability, resilience, flexibility, and affordability. EPE provides full-spectrum consulting, grid modeling, and innovative software solutions to support new generation interconnection (including renewables integration), energy storage, transmission and distribution planning, and digital transformation. Trusted by utilities, developers, data center operators, regulatory agencies, and enterprise clients,

EPE helps solve complex power system challenges to build the grid of the future. Headquartered in Austin, Texas, with offices in Canada, Panama, and Lebanon, EPE operates across North America, Latin America, the Middle East, and North Africa. Learn more at www.epeconsulting.com.
